Webb17 juni 2012 · I'm using Sass (.scss) for my current project. Following example: HTML Hello World SCSS.container { … Webb26 juli 2024 · This is the current specified syntax in CSS Nesting 1. It offers a convenient way to nest appending styles by starting new nested selectors with &. It also offers @nest as a way to place the & context anywhere inside a new selector, like when you're not just appending subjects. WebbDue to the way browsers render various CSS selectors, p { color: red } will be many times slower when scoped (i.e. when combined with an attribute selector). If you use classes or ids instead, such as in .example { color: red }, then you virtually eliminate that performance hit. Be careful with descendant selectors in recursive components! overlays on obs

Before we write any Sass code, let's learn the basics of Sass syntax. Sass File Types. The Sass transpiler supports two different file types: .sass and .scss - each with its own extension and syntax. Prior to version 3, Sass files used the .sass extension, and used an indented syntax similar to haml.In version 3, Sass introduced the .scss format ("Sassy …
